Network Architecture
Every hackable system is a network — a collection of connected nodes defended by ICE (Intrusion Countermeasures Electronics). Understanding network architecture is the first step to cracking it open.
Network Tiers
Networks have tiers that determine their complexity, security, and the quality of data within them.
| Network Tier | Example | Nodes | ICE Layers | Base Breach DC |
|---|---|---|---|---|
| Tier 1 — Scrap Net | Settlement bulletin board, abandoned terminal | 1-3 | 0-1 | DC 12 |
| Tier 2 — Local Net | Small settlement network, merchant database, clinic records | 3-5 | 1-2 | DC 14 |
| Tier 3 — Secured Net | Faction headquarters, military outpost, research lab | 5-8 | 2-3 | DC 17 |
| Tier 4 — Hardened Net | Corporate vault, AI-defended installation, orbital relay | 8-12 | 3-4 | DC 20 |
| Tier 5 — Fortress Net | Pre-Fall megacorp mainframe, alien data construct, sentient AI core | 12-20 | 4-5 | DC 24 |
Nodes
A node is a discrete system within a network — a server, a terminal, a sensor array, a door controller. Each node has a type that determines what a hacker can do once they reach it.
| Node Type | Function | What You Can Do |
|---|---|---|
| Gateway | Network entry point | Establish connection, authenticate, or breach |
| Data Store | File servers, databases, archives | Extract data, plant false records, corrupt files |
| Control | Door locks, turrets, environmental systems | Open/close doors, redirect turrets, adjust life support |
| Comm Relay | Radio, satellite uplink, mesh repeater | Intercept messages, broadcast signals, jam frequencies |
| Security Hub | ICE deployment, alarm systems, logging | Disable alarms, suppress ICE, erase intrusion logs |
| AI Core | Autonomous intelligence, expert systems | Query the AI, negotiate, attempt override, extract knowledge |
| Processing | Computational resources, data analysis | Run decryption, analyze datasets, compile programs |
| Vault | High-security isolated storage | Access top-secret data, encryption keys, system master controls |
Node Connections: Nodes are connected in a topology. The GM maps the network as a simple diagram — nodes connected by lines. A hacker moves through the network node by node, like moving through rooms in a dungeon.
Network Topology Types
| Topology | Description | Hacking Implication |
|---|---|---|
| Linear | Nodes in a chain (A→B→C→D) | Must traverse in order. Simple but predictable. |
| Star | All nodes connect to a central hub | Compromise the hub = access everything. Hub is heavily defended. |
| Mesh | Every node connects to multiple others | Multiple paths to any target. Hard to lock down, but also hard to navigate. |
| Tree | Branching hierarchy (root→branches→leaves) | Must climb from leaf to branch to root. Each branch may have its own ICE. |
| Airgapped | No external connections | Physical access required. Cannot be hacked remotely. Must plug in. |
ICE (Intrusion Countermeasures Electronics)
ICE is automated security software that protects networks. When a hacker trips ICE, it activates and begins countermeasures. ICE comes in three categories: White, Gray, and Black.

Intrusion Procedure
A hack follows a five-phase procedure. In combat, each phase takes 1 action. During downtime, each phase takes the listed time.
Phase 1: Reconnaissance
Before attempting a breach, a hacker scans the target network to assess its defenses.
Check: Hacking or Technology vs. DC 12 (Tier 1) to DC 20 (Tier 5) Time: 10 minutes (downtime) or 1 action (combat, with disadvantage)
Success reveals (choose a number equal to margin of success ÷ 2, minimum 1):
- Network tier and topology type
- Number and type of ICE layers
- Number of nodes (approximate)
- Location of a specific node type (if you know what you're looking for)
- Whether an AI guardian is present
- Known vulnerabilities (+2 to your next Breach check)
Failure: You learn nothing useful. Failure by 5+ alerts the network that someone is probing.
Phase 2: Breach
Gain initial access to the network through the Gateway node.
Check: Hacking vs. the network's Base Breach DC (see Network Tiers table) Time: 1 minute (downtime) or 1 action (combat)
Breach Methods:
| Method | Modifier | Notes |
|---|---|---|
| Brute Force | -2 to DC | Fast but loud. Automatically triggers Watchdog ICE if present. |
| Exploit Vulnerability | -4 to DC | Requires successful Recon that identified a vulnerability. |
| Social Engineering | Use Deception instead of Hacking | Trick an authorized user into providing access. Only works if a user is present. |
| Physical Access | -5 to DC | Direct hardwire connection to a node. Requires being physically at the terminal. |
| Credential Theft | Auto-success on Gateway | Requires stolen credentials (looted, pickpocketed, or socially engineered). Access level limited to the credential holder's clearance. |
Success: You're in. You now occupy the Gateway node and can navigate to adjacent nodes. Failure: Breach fails. You can retry, but each failure after the first increases the DC by 2 (the system adapts). Failure by 5+: Lockout triggers (Tier 3+) or countermeasures deploy.
Phase 3: Navigate
Move through the network from node to node, bypassing ICE as you encounter it.
Check: Hacking vs. ICE bypass DC (see ICE tables) for each layer of ICE Time: 1 round per node (combat) or 5 minutes per node (downtime)
Navigation Options:
- Move to Adjacent Node: Standard movement. Encounter any ICE defending that node.
- Stealth Traverse: Move without triggering Watchdog ICE. Hacking check vs. Watchdog's detection DC. Failure triggers the Watchdog.
- Map Network: Spend an action to reveal all nodes adjacent to your current node and their types.
- Bypass ICE: Attempt to disable or circumvent ICE blocking your path. On success, the ICE is suppressed for 1 minute (combat) or 10 minutes (downtime).
- Destroy ICE: Permanently disable ICE. Requires beating the bypass DC by 5+. The network administrator knows ICE was destroyed and can rebuild it during downtime.
Phase 4: Execute
Once you reach your target node, perform the action you came for.
Check: Depends on the action (see Node Actions below) Time: 1 action (combat) or varies (downtime)
Phase 5: Exfiltrate
Get out cleanly. Exfiltration is automatic if no alarms have been triggered. If the network is on alert:
Check: Hacking vs. DC 15 (alert level 1) / DC 18 (alert level 2) / DC 22 (alert level 3) Time: 1 action (combat) or 1 minute (downtime)
Clean Exit: No evidence of your presence beyond what Loggers recorded. Messy Exit: Disconnect immediately Free but leave traces. Network administrators can identify your neural interface signature or device MAC address with a Technology DC 16 check. Trapped: If you fail exfiltration while Black ICE is active, you take one more hit from the ICE before disconnecting.

Hacking in Combat
When hacking during active combat (not leisurely downtime), the following modifications apply:
Action Economy
- Each intrusion phase costs 1 action
- Bypassing ICE costs 1 action per ICE layer
- Node actions cost 1 action unless specified
- You can hack and take other actions on the same turn (3-action economy)
- You must maintain line of effect (an unbroken signal path — wireless range, wired connection, or network relay; not the same as line of sight) to a connected device or be within Neural Interface range
Concentration
Active hacking requires concentration, following the same core rules as spell concentration (see Magic — Concentration).
Will save DC: When you take damage while connected to a network, make a Will save. The DC equals 10 or half the damage taken, whichever is higher.
On failure: You are disconnected from the network entirely. Your avatar is ejected, all active hacking effects end, and you must re-breach the network from scratch on a subsequent turn. This includes losing control of any redirected systems (turrets, doors, locks).
Single concentration slot: You can maintain only one concentration effect at a time — whether that's an active hack, a redirected turret, a redirected security system, or a spell requiring concentration. If you redirect a turret (which requires concentration), you cannot simultaneously concentrate on a spell or maintain control of another system. Starting a new concentration effect ends the previous one.
Standing orders: Systems you've already reprogrammed (permanently changing friend/foe designations, disabled alarms, unlocked doors) do not require concentration. Only active, ongoing control (turret targeting, system override, live monitoring) requires concentration.

Digital Combat (Hacker vs. Hacker)
When two hackers meet inside a network, combat resolves through a 3-round Digital Duel — a structured battle of wits, exploits, and nerve. Each round represents seconds of furious code execution and counter-intrusion.
Initiative: Both hackers roll Initiative normally. The higher Initiative acts first in each round.
Round 1 — Probe: Both hackers make contested Technology checks. The winner learns the opponent's loaded programs, connection method (neural interface, deck, terminal), and current network access level. The loser learns nothing. Tie: both learn connection method only.
Round 2 — Exploit: Both hackers make contested Technology checks. The winner chooses one effect:
- Eject from Node (Safe): Opponent is pushed out of the current node and must spend 1 action to return.
- Deploy ICE (Aggressive): A program you have loaded activates against the opponent as if they triggered it. The opponent must resolve the ICE normally.
- Steal Program (Risky): Attempt to copy one of the opponent's loaded programs. The opponent makes a Will save (DC = your Technology DC). On failure, you copy the program into an empty slot. On success, you learn which program they protected but gain nothing.
Round 3 — Resolution: Final contested Technology check. Results:
- Win by 5+: Opponent is ejected from the network, takes 2d8 psychic damage, and their connection point is traced (you learn their physical location).
- Win by 1-4: Opponent is ejected from the current node only. No damage. No trace.
- Tie: Both hackers are ejected from the node. Neither takes damage.
Disengage: At the start of any round, either hacker can Disengage as a free action, exiting the duel. The disengaging hacker is ejected from the current node (not the network) and the network alert level increases by one step.
Action Economy: Each round of a Digital Duel costs 1 action per hacker. A 3-round duel consumes all 3 actions in a turn. If one hacker has actions remaining after the duel ends (e.g., the opponent Disengaged in Round 2), they can use remaining actions normally.

Network Alerts
Networks have four alert levels that escalate as intrusion is detected.
| Alert Level | Triggers (any one) | Effect |
|---|---|---|
| Green (Normal) | Default state | No additional security. ICE operates normally. |
| Yellow (Suspicious) | Failed hack check by 3+; Watchdog ICE triggered; Logger records 3+ unauthorized access events in 1 minute; ICE bypassed but not disabled | +2 to all ICE DCs. Active administrator may engage. Patrol frequency doubles in physical facility. |
| Red (Breach Confirmed) | Failed hack check by 5+; any ICE destroyed (not bypassed); alarm manually triggered by administrator or physical security; Black ICE activated; 3+ Yellow triggers accumulated in single intrusion | +4 to all ICE DCs. All dormant ICE activates. Physical security responds in 1d4 minutes. Network may initiate controlled shutdown. |
| Lockdown | 3+ Red triggers accumulated in single intrusion; Trace ICE completes its countdown | Network locks all Gateways for 1 hour. Physical-only access or a Tier 5+ exploit (Technology DC 26) can re-enter. All active hackers are forcibly disconnected and take 2d8 psychic damage (Will save for half, DC 18). |
De-escalation: If no intrusion activity is detected for 10 minutes (downtime) or 5 rounds (combat), the alert level drops by one step. Reaching the Security Hub and disabling alarms drops the alert level to Green immediately. Lockdown cannot be de-escalated — it must expire (1 hour) or be bypassed.
Logger clarification: A Logger ICE records each unauthorized access event (failed check, bypassed ICE, accessed restricted node). Three recorded events within 1 minute automatically triggers a Yellow alert. The Logger itself does not count as a "Yellow trigger" for Red escalation — only the resulting Yellow alert does.

Secure Tunnels
A secure tunnel is an encrypted point-to-point communication channel that resists interception, tracing, and tampering. Tunnels are critical infrastructure for factions, trade networks, and covert operations.
Creating a Secure Tunnel
Requirements:
- Two endpoints (physical devices: comm relay, server, terminal, neural interface)
- Both endpoints must be powered and operational
- Hacking or Technology proficiency
Check: Technology DC 16 (local, <1 mile) / DC 18 (regional, <50 miles) / DC 22 (long-range, <500 miles) / DC 26 (satellite relay, unlimited) Time: 1 hour (local) / 4 hours (regional) / 1 day (long-range) / 3 days (satellite) Cost: 50 cr + 2 Tech (local) / 200 cr + 5 Tech (regional) / 1,000 cr + 10 Tech (long-range) / 5,000 cr + 25 Tech (satellite)
Tunnel Properties
| Property | Description |
|---|---|
| Encrypted | All data transmitted is encrypted at the tunnel tier. Intercepting requires beating the encryption DC. |
| Authenticated | Only authorized users can connect. Spoofing credentials requires Hacking vs. the tunnel's creation DC + 4. |
| Point-to-Point | Cannot be redirected. Data goes from A to B only. |
| Bandwidth | Supports text, voice, and low-resolution data transfer. Video requires a Tier 3+ tunnel. Streaming sensor data requires Tier 4+. |
Tunnel Encryption Tiers
| Tier | Encryption DC to Break | Notes |
|---|---|---|
| Basic | DC 16 | Scrambled signal. Deters casual eavesdropping. |
| Standard | DC 20 | Military-grade encryption. Requires Hacking skill to break. |
| Advanced | DC 24 | Pre-Fall corporate encryption. Only master hackers can crack it. |
| Quantum | DC 28 | Theoretically unbreakable. Requires alien tech or AI assistance to establish. |
Maintaining Tunnels
Tunnels require periodic maintenance or they degrade:
- Check: Technology DC 12, once per month
- Failure: Tunnel reliability drops. 25% chance per use that the connection drops or data is corrupted.
- Neglected for 3+ months: Tunnel collapses. Must be re-established from scratch.
Physical damage to either endpoint immediately severs the tunnel.
Tunnel Operations
Who can create a tunnel? Any character with Hacking or Technology proficiency and access to a compatible endpoint device (comm relay, server, terminal, or neural interface). The initiating endpoint must be a device you physically control or are currently hacked into.
Endpoint initiation: Once a tunnel is established, either endpoint can initiate communication. The receiving endpoint does not need an operator — data can be sent to an unmanned terminal for later retrieval.
Can tunnels be traced? Standard ICE and network monitoring cannot detect an active secure tunnel. Detecting a tunnel requires one of:
- An Adaptive AI or higher (cognitive level 4+) actively scanning: Investigation DC 22
- A dedicated counter-intrusion scan by a skilled hacker: Technology DC 20, requires 10 minutes of active scanning
- Physical inspection of the endpoint hardware: Investigation DC 18, requires physical access to the device
Tunnel destruction: Destroying or powering down either endpoint immediately closes the tunnel. Data in transit at the moment of closure is lost. The remaining endpoint receives a "connection terminated" alert but no information about why.
Tunnel limits: A single device can maintain a maximum of 3 simultaneous tunnels. Each additional tunnel beyond 3 requires a Technology DC 20 check to establish (the device's bandwidth is strained).

API Interfaces
An API (Automated Protocol Interface) connects two services or systems, allowing them to share data and trigger actions automatically. APIs are the glue that turns isolated systems into integrated infrastructure.
Creating an API:
- Check: Technology DC 16 (simple data sharing) / DC 18 (conditional triggers) / DC 22 (complex multi-system integration)
- Time: 4 hours (simple) / 1 day (conditional) / 3 days (complex)
- Cost: 25 cr + 1 Tech (simple) / 75 cr + 2 Tech (conditional) / 200 cr + 5 Tech (complex)
API Types
| API Type | Function | Example |
|---|---|---|
| Data Sync | Automatically share data between two Data Stores. | Medical Database syncs patient records with a remote clinic. |
| Alert Trigger | When a condition is met on one system, trigger an action on another. | Surveillance Grid detects intruder → Control Hub locks doors → Comm Hub sends alert. |
| Remote Access | Allow authorized users to access a system from a different network. | Crafting Archive accessible from a field terminal 50 miles away via secure tunnel. |
| Automated Commerce | Process buy/sell transactions between Marketplace Portals. | Settlement A's surplus grain auto-listed on Settlement B's marketplace at agreed prices. |
| Sensor Aggregation | Combine data from multiple sensor sources into a single feed. | Drone camera + surveillance grid + perimeter sensors → Tactical Overlay. |
| Command Relay | Issue commands to remote systems through an intermediary. | Hacker sends commands through a comm relay to control a turret network in another building. |
API Security
APIs are attack vectors. Every API you create is a potential pathway for hackers.
- Unsecured API: Any hacker who reaches the API's node can use it to access the connected system. They don't need to breach the remote system separately.
- Authenticated API: Requires credentials. Adds the API creation DC as the bypass DC for unauthorized use.
- Rate-Limited API: Only processes a set number of requests per minute. Prevents brute-force attacks but limits legitimate throughput.
- Encrypted API: Data in transit is encrypted at the tunnel tier used by the connection.
Best Practice: Always run APIs through secure tunnels with authentication. An unsecured API connecting your base's control hub to a remote turret is an invitation for someone to turn your own guns on you.
